Mi Pad 6 Launched

OneTapHero

Disciple
  • 11-inch (2880 x 1800) 16:10 display 144hz variable refresh rate, HDR 10, Dolby Vision, 99% DCI-P3 colour gamut, Corning Gorilla Glass 3 protection
  • Snapdragon 870
  • 6GB LPDDR5 with 128GB UFS 3.1 storage / 8GB LPDDR5 with 256GB UFS 3.1 storage
  • Android 13 with MIUI 14 for tablets
  • 13MP camera with f/2.2 aperture, PDAF
  • 8MP front camera with 105° FoV and focus frame
  • USB Type-C audio, Dolby Atmos, 4 Speakers, 4 microphones
  • Wi-Fi 6 802.11 ax (2.4GHz + 5GHz), Bluetooth 5.2
  • USB 3.2 Gen1 for up to 4K 60fps output
  • 8840mAh (typical)/8640mAh (min) battery with 33W fast charging
